Maintaining Workplace Hygiene Through Advanced Cleanroom Garment Management Services

Industries operating in contamination-controlled environments require highly organized hygiene systems to maintain workplace cleanliness, operational consistency, and product safety. Sectors such as pharmaceuticals, biotechnology, healthcare, laboratories, semiconductor manufacturing, and cleanroom production facilities depend heavily on disciplined contamination-control practices where garment hygiene plays a critical role.

As industrial hygiene standards continue evolving, businesses are increasingly focusing on professional cleanroom garment management services that support contamination-sensitive workflows and structured garment lifecycle management.

Cleanroom garments are not standard industrial uniforms. These garments are part of a contamination-control system designed to help reduce particle exposure, maintain workplace hygiene, and support regulated operational environments. Proper garment handling, processing, storage, and tracking are essential to maintaining cleanroom standards and operational reliability.

Why Cleanroom Garment Management Matters

Personnel working inside controlled environments are one of the largest sources of contamination risk. Garments used in cleanrooms continuously interact with operational environments where maintaining cleanliness is critical for both workplace safety and product quality.

Improper garment handling or inconsistent hygiene practices can compromise contamination-control processes and affect operational performance.

This is why organizations increasingly rely on professionally managed cleanroom garment lifecycle management systems that help maintain garment hygiene and operational consistency throughout the garment usage cycle.

Professional garment management includes more than laundering alone. It involves complete control over garment handling, tracking, washing, inspection, packaging, transportation, and replacement planning.

A structured garment management system helps businesses maintain cleaner operational environments while reducing contamination-related operational risks.

The Role of Garment Lifecycle Management

Modern cleanroom operations require garments to move through multiple controlled stages before returning to operational use. Every stage must support contamination-sensitive handling and hygiene-focused workflows.

Professional garment lifecycle management generally includes:

  • Garment procurement and allocation
  • Controlled garment collection systems
  • Segregated garment processing
  • Industrial washing and hygienic drying
  • Garment inspection and quality verification
  • Hygienic folding and packaging
  • Delivery and redistribution management
  • Garment tracking and replacement planning

RFID-Based Garment Tracking and Visibility

Modern cleanroom operations increasingly rely on technology-driven garment management systems to improve process visibility and garment traceability.

RFID-enabled garment tracking systems help organizations monitor garment movement, usage cycles, and replacement schedules more effectively.

Structured garment tracking systems help improve:

  • Inventory visibility
  • Garment lifecycle monitoring
  • Replacement planning
  • Workflow transparency
  • Operational accountability

Industries increasingly prioritize RFID garment tracking cleanroom systems because they support organized garment circulation and better process management within contamination-sensitive environments.

Technology-driven garment management also contributes toward more efficient operational planning and improved hygiene coordination across facilities.
